Output e288b792588ae3ad6bed9ebde855ccb548d51e1c2594fc3eb7a77a7b16cab73a:81

value
31055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02603a88a32ae19e8912ce6e85fa8b445844f967 OP_EQUAL
address
31uaZ1bS7BwHdL5PwPC1GNQcxzSSQR3wy5
transaction
e288b792588ae3ad6bed9ebde855ccb548d51e1c2594fc3eb7a77a7b16cab73a
spent
true